Vegan Baked Fried Rice with Soy Gochujang Sauce
Yields: 2 Servings

“Fried rice is a classic dish that everyone loves. However, sometimes you don't want to sit by the stove as your fried rice cooks. That is where this vegan baked fried rice with soy gochujang sauce comes in.” - Kristi Roeder
Ingredients
Fried Rice
1 (10oz) package Hodo Organic Extra Firm Tofu, crumbled into small pieces Locate Product
2 cups cooked and cooled brown rice (you can prep this ahead of time)
1 head medium sized broccoli, cut into small pieces
2 tbsp sesame oil
1/2 - 1 tsp salt
1 tsp garlic powder
Black pepper to taste
Sauce
3 tbsp soy sauce
2 tbsp rice wine vinegar
2 tbsp gochujang paste
1 garlic clove - minced
2 tsp maple syrup
1 tsp grated ginger
Optional Toppings
1/2 diced avocado
1/4 cup chopping scallions
Instructions
Preheat oven to 425 degrees.
Add rice, carrots, tofu and broccoli to a sheet pan lined with parchment paper. Coat in oil, salt, pepper and garlic powder. Bake for 30-35 minutes.
Add sauce ingredients to a bowl and mix together until smooth.
Divide out fried rice into two bowls, pour sauce evenly over both servings. Top with scallions and avocado if using
